    5:10 "Heavy water slows down the speed of neutrons more than light water simply because it is heavier" ... I thought that light water is a better moderator in terms of elastic scattering, but the hydrogen tends to absorb more neutrons, making the chain reaction more difficult (impossible?) to achieve.
